We prove an $\tilde{\Omega}(n^2)$ lower bound for read-once parity branching programs computing an explicit boolean function on $n$ variables. The previous best lower bound was $\tilde{\Omega}(n^{1.5})$. Our lower bound is proved by reducing the problem to a lower bound in algebraic circuit complexity.
